文件名称:IPv6教学软件的设计和实现
介绍说明--下载内容均来自于网络,请自行研究使用
本文详细讨论了一套IPv6的教学软件的设计和开发实现过程,其中重点研
究了软件设计实现中的技术细节,该软件在linux操作系统中实现,使用
GCC/Q州开发工具。研究内容包括IPv6实现特点;互联网嗅探技术的原理与
危害;基于libpcap函数库开发网络数据的捕获和解析;基于libnet函数库的协
议仿真编辑和发送,能够自己构造特定协议的数据包,如ARP9 ETHERNET,IP,
IPv6,TCP和UDP等,让协议运作过程一目了然;还研究了软件的界面设计,
通过gtk界面设计语言开发界面,并运用多线程多进程编程与网络数据分析接121
函数相结合,达到软件教学的效果。
通过该软件学生能对下一代网络
究了软件设计实现中的技术细节,该软件在linux操作系统中实现,使用
GCC/Q州开发工具。研究内容包括IPv6实现特点;互联网嗅探技术的原理与
危害;基于libpcap函数库开发网络数据的捕获和解析;基于libnet函数库的协
议仿真编辑和发送,能够自己构造特定协议的数据包,如ARP9 ETHERNET,IP,
IPv6,TCP和UDP等,让协议运作过程一目了然;还研究了软件的界面设计,
通过gtk界面设计语言开发界面,并运用多线程多进程编程与网络数据分析接121
函数相结合,达到软件教学的效果。
通过该软件学生能对下一代网络
(系统自动生成,下载前可以参看下载内容)
下载文件列表
压缩包 : IPv6教学软件的设计和实现.zip 列表 IPv6教学软件的设计和实现.pdf